Project Title: Miniature Piezo Preamp PCB (10mm) – Reverse Engineer & Redesign

Project Overview

I am developing a professional leak detection microphone used for plumbing diagnostics. The system uses a piezoelectric sensor to detect vibration and sound from water leaks inside pipes.

I already have a working preamp circuit, but the PCB is too large for my application. I need an experienced electronics engineer to analyze the existing design and redesign it into a much smaller PCB.

The new design must maintain similar electrical performance but reduce the physical size so it can be mounted directly on the piezo sensor and permanently sealed with epoxy resin inside a capsule.

Primary Objectives

1. Analyze or replicate the functionality of my existing piezo preamp.
2. Redesign the circuit into a very small PCB (target size ~10mm × 10mm).
3. Maintain good signal quality and low noise.
4. Optimize the design for piezoelectric sensor input.

Technical Requirements

• Designed specifically for piezoelectric sensor input
• High input impedance suitable for piezo pickup
• Low noise analog design
• Single supply operation (9V battery system)
• Small SMD components (0402 or 0603 preferred)
• Compact op-amp or JFET input stage recommended
• Minimal component count preferred
• Output signal will go to a separate main amplifier board

PCB Requirements

• Target PCB size: approximately 10mm × 10mm
• Components on ONE SIDE ONLY (top side SMT assembly)
• Bottom side must remain flat to allow mounting to the piezo sensor
• Board will be encapsulated with resin, so layout must be mechanically reliable

Connections

The board must support three wires:

V+ (power supply)
GND
Signal Output

The piezo sensor will be soldered directly to pads on the PCB.
